Buying Guide
Key considerations when selecting an 8-pin microphone connector include compatibility (GX16 vs DIN-style), mechanical durability, and intended use environment. If you need a panel-mounted solution, prefer GX16 16 mm with metal construction. For field or aviation use, a DIN-compatible plug with copper conductors offers reliable power transmission. Consider the number of mating cycles the connector supports and whether a nickel finish is required for corrosion resistance.
Practical questions to guide your choice:
- What equipment will the connector interface with (transceivers, aviation gear, or cb radios)?
- Is a panel-mounted or cable-end connector required?
- Do you need a rugged metal housing or a lighter plastic body?
- Are there space or diameter constraints around the connector?

FAQ
- What does GX16 mean in connectors? Answer: GX16 designates a common aviation-style circular connector with a 16 mm shell diameter and 8 contact positions. It is widely used for panels and harnesses in radio and automation projects.
- Are 8-pin connectors interchangeable between brands? Answer: Not always. Verify pin arrangements, shell size, and mating types before swapping connectors to avoid misalignment or poor contact.
- What is the advantage of metal over plastic connectors? Answer: Metal housings resist impact and corrosion, provide better shielding, and improve durability in field installations.
- Do these connectors support high current? Answer: Current ratings vary; some GX16 connectors support up to about 15A, but always check the specific product’s current rating and wiring method.
- How important is nickel plating? Answer: Nickel plating improves corrosion resistance and longevity in harsh environments, beneficial for outdoor or industrial use.
